For fun on corners you just need some cheap old worn tyres
Seriously, I just discovered what a difference a tyre can make. The car came with retreaded (remould) tyres that were worn to zero and they were slipping in the dry with normal driving. Now with new "real" tyres, it can be driven quite dynamically even in the wet with confidence. The old tyres also made a sound of failing wheel bearings
